Background Information: Garfield [Top] Garfield: The Movie is a 2004 live action movie based on the Jim Davis comic strip Garfield. In this movie, Garfield the cat was created with computer-generated imagery, though all other animals were real. The movie was directed by Peter Hewitt & stars Breckin Meyer as Jon Arbuckle, Jennifer Love Hewitt as Dr Liz Wilson & features Bill Murray as the voice of Garfield the Cat. The movie was released in the United States on June 11, 2004. Reviews of the movie were generally very negative, other than some which looked favorably on Murrays voice work. Garfield. It was written by John Hopkins & directed by Ken Kwapis. The Majestic Hotel is a 5-star luxury establishment & manager Robert Grant is devoted to keeping his guests happy. Grant is informed from the chairman of the hotel that a sixth star could be rewarded to the Majestic Hotel, if a certain representative is impressed & that this representitive is posing as a guest of the Majestic Hotel. However, a certain guest by the name of Lord Rutledge checks in with his orangutan, Dunston, who is trained as a jewel thief. Dunston attempts to escape a life of crime with the help of Kyle & Brian, Grants mischievous sons, but this just might destroy the chances of the hotel becoming a 6-star establishment. Biography: Bill Murray [Top] William James Murray is an American comedian, producer, film director & actor. Bill was raised in Wilmette, Illinois & graduated from Loyola Academy. Murray initially rose to prominence as a cast member of & a writer for NBC s Saturday Night Live television series from 1977 to 1980. Most of his roles have been comedic, featuring Murrays dry wit. However, he has also played serious roles in films such as Mad Dog & Glory, The Razors Edge & Rushmore. He also garnered considerable acclaim as the lead in the 2003 film Lost in Translation.
